Nora ee1a397bd5 fix(sp41): 2010BB payer loop ordering + patient loop structure + visits table
**The bug.** The 837P X12 005010X222A1 IG requires the Payer Name
loop (2010BB / NM1*PR) to live INSIDE 2000B, AFTER the subscriber's
DMG and BEFORE 2000C (HL*3, the patient loop). The previous
serializer emitted NM1*PR AFTER the patient loop, which pyX12 caught
as 'Mandatory loop 2010BB missing' on round-trip. The 10/10 spot-check
files were therefore structurally invalid per the IG even though they
round-tripped through our own parser (which silently swallowed the
misplaced NM1*PR).

**The fix.**
1. Move 2010BB into 2000B in `_build_subscriber_block` so the order
   is now: HL*2 → SBR → NM1*IL → N3 → N4 → DMG → NM1*PR → HL*3
   → PAT → NM1*QC → N3 → N4 → DMG → CLM.
2. Add `_consume_patient_loop` to `parse_837.py` so the 2000B
   subscriber iteration skips past the 2000C patient loop and
   finds loop 2300 (CLM) — the parser was previously relying on
   the (invalid) old ordering.
3. Strip NM108/NM109 from NM1*QC (the IG marks these as 'Not Used')
   via the QC branch of `_build_nm1`.
4. Add PAT*01 segment (PAT is required whenever 2000C is emitted).
5. Add `include_patient_loop` flag so callers can opt out (e.g.
   Patient==Subscriber cases that don't need a 2000C loop at all).
6. Bump HL*2 child count to 1 when 2000C is emitted (was 0 or 1
   inconsistently).

Nora dc5bff617d fix(sp37-followup): load BACKFILL_SQL from migration file (no drift)
Followup #4 from the SP37 final-state tracker. The previous
BACKFILL_SQL constant in test_migration_0020.py was a hand-copied
duplicate of the migration's UPDATE statement. A future contributor
could edit one without the other and the test would silently
replay a different SQL than production — defeating the regression.

Fix: tests now load the migration file at test time and extract
its UPDATE via the same splitter db_migrate.run() uses (strip
'--' comments, split on ';'). The test can never disagree with
what production runs.

sp37 bot 0067ecc5da feat(sp37): add batches.transaction_set_control_number column
Migration 0020 adds the column additively (nullable, no default) and
backfills from raw_result_json.envelope.transaction_set_control_number
for any existing batch rows that already carry it. Required for the
SP37 join-key update so 999 acks can resolve by ST02 (the source 837's
transaction set control number) instead of just ISA13.
